GLENSIDE, Pa. – The Arcadia University women's soccer team played its final home game of the season on Tuesday night as they took down the Lions of Albright College 3-1. Sophomore Kayla Haberbosch scored two goals for the Knights to secure the win.
Haberbosch opened the scoring in the sixth minute. The Allentown, Pa. native was on the receiving end of a through ball from Mia Bertolami on the right side of the box which she was able to poke past the keeper.
Tara Smith picked up where she left off on Sunday as she picked up her third goal in two games, her fourth of the season, in the 54th minute; the goal would prove to be the game-winner. The sophomore headed the ball into the right corner of the net on a cross from Jess Kelly. Haberbosch capped the scoring for the Scarlet and Grey on a breakaway shot from the center of the box in the 70th minute.
The Lions tallied their lone goal off a rebound in the 85th minute.
Arcadia outshot the visitors 18-4 overall, with each side registering 11 and two shots on goal respectively. Evelyn Feigeles made one save to pick up her 12th win of the season. Payton Bogatch picks up the loss making seven saves.
The 12-5 Knights wrap up the season on Saturday at Hood. The Scarlet and Grey currently sit in a three-way tie for the second seed in the MAC Commonwealth playoffs.
